Q: Is 44,764 a Prime Number?
A: No, 44,764 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 44764 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 19 31 38 62 76 124 361 589 722 1,178 1,444 2,356 11,191 22,382 and 44,764, with no remainder.
Since 44,764 cannot be divided by just 1 and 44,764, it is not a prime number.
